Veteran defenders Stefan de Vrij and Francesco Acerbi are both set to stay at Inter Milan this summer transfer window.
This according to today’s print edition of Milan-based newspaper Gazzetta dello Sport, via FCInterNews.
Stefan de Vrij and Francesco Acerbi have been bedrocks of Inter Milan’s defense for some time.
De Vrij joined Inter in the summer of 2018 from Lazio. Meanwhile, Acerbi as been at the Nerazzurri since 2022, also arriving from the Biancocelesti.
There is no getting around the fact that both de Vrij and Acerbi are well on the wrong side of thirty, however.
De Vrij will turn 34 over the next season. Meanwhile, Acerbi will turn 38.
De Vrij & Acerbi To Stay At Inter Milan

According to the Gazzetta dello Sport, however, Inter have no plan to offload either de Vrij or Acerbi this summer.
It is undoubtedly true that one of Inter’s priorities this summer is to lower the average squad age.
And in multiple areas of the pitch, the Nerazzurri have done just that.
However, in defense Inter are sticking with de Vrij and Acerbi.
Both of the two ex-Lazio veterans see their contracts with Inter run out at the end of next June. And there would be little chance of either sticking out beyond then.
However, for now, Inter will keep the reliable veterans on.
